The Power and Perils of Leadership in 'Fuego Cruzado'

Virlán García's song 'Fuego Cruzado' delves into the complex and often perilous world of organized crime, specifically focusing on the life of a high-ranking cartel leader. The lyrics paint a vivid picture of a man who is both intelligent and trustworthy, navigating the treacherous waters of cartel politics. The protagonist makes it clear that he is not affiliated with any political party, emphasizing his independence and the unique power he wields. The mention of 'nuevos carteles' and 'nuevo armamento' suggests a constant evolution and adaptation to maintain control and dominance in a volatile environment.

The song also touches on the harsh realities and constant threats that come with such a position. Despite the cold winds and the passage of time, the protagonist remains unshaken, highlighting his resilience and the established reign of his 'trono.' The reference to 'el señor Aquiles' and his communications indicates a structured hierarchy and the importance of clear directives within the cartel. Tijuana, a city often associated with cartel activity, serves as the backdrop, further grounding the song in a real-world context.

'Fuego Cruzado' also explores themes of loyalty and betrayal, crucial elements in the world of organized crime. The protagonist speaks of protecting the 'línea' and the legacy of the 'capo de capos,' underscoring the weight of responsibility on his shoulders. The changing times and increasing betrayals are acknowledged, yet he remains steadfast, continuing to lead and progress. The song concludes with a reaffirmation of his dedication and the strength derived from his southern allies, encapsulating the essence of a leader who is both feared and respected, navigating a world where power is constantly contested and survival is never guaranteed.
